Moving images from "real" members categories

I'd like to either have "real" sub-categories created under categories that are listed as "Act as Members Category" or be able to move existing members images into the "Acting Category". Hopefully that makes sense

I've got a few members that have created "real" sub-cats under RC2. With the ability to create members sub-cats on the fly I'd like to move their pictures into those "fake" sub-categories. The way it is now, on the main page the "real" sub-categories will show if set to display and the "fake" ones don't.

If I set it so that the sub-cats aren't displayed then it adds another level of redirection to gain access to the user's pictures for the existing sub-cats.

Re: Moving images from "real" members categories

A quick query should do the job...

UPDATE adv_gallery_images SET catid = 'NewMembersCatidHere' WHERE catid IN (X, Y, Z);

Be sure to back up your database, or at least your 'adv_gallery_images' table before trying that though just to be safe.
